Jackson Hole Book Festival

Web: https://jacksonholebookfestival.org/

The Jackson Hole Book Festival is a vibrant one-day literary celebration that brings together authors and readers for meaningful conversations and community connection.

Held annually at the Snow King Resort in Jackson, Wyoming, the Jackson Hole Book Festival (JHBF) was founded in 2022 by Sharon Felzer and Kathleen Brown with the goal of fostering civil discourse, intellectual engagement, and community dialogue through literature. The festival is free and open to all, emphasizing inclusivity and accessibility.
